Education Resource Booklets
These downloadable resource booklets are designed to assist teachers in interpreting the content of Van Gogh, Dalí and Beyond. They contain information about the exhibition, artists and art styles, the genres of portrait, landscape and still life and discussion questions based on works in the exhibition.
